From the 11-15th March, Craft Northern Ireland are coming over for an exhibition in Clerkenwell at Craft Central.

This is a free five day exhibition presenting the best of contemporary craft by makers living and working Northern Ireland and is the first overseas event for Craft Northern Ireland.

It will be a celebration of the beautiful work coming out of Northern Ireland and features sculpture, glass, wood turning and fabric work.

The overall exhibition is aimed at showcasing the very best designer-makers within the contemporary craft sector in Northern Ireland. Craft NI will offer a 'show within a show' entitled Perspective: Inspiration Unveiled; a dedicated installation exhibiting the work of 13 hand picked craftsmen and women from Northern Ireland, drawing attention to the wealth and cultural strength of artistic talent this unique province has to offer. From jewellery designers to sculptors, ceramists, weavers, glass blowers and furniture designers, there will be a wide array of disciplines represented.

Supported by the Creative Industries Innovation Fund, the exhibition will tie in with St Patrick's Day celebrations. This project is the first overseas event for Craft NI, and aims to develop the partnership between Craft NI and Craft Central and also to broker new partnerships with other leading London based craft organisations, with a view to expanding future export opportunities for makers. Sponsors for the launch event and exhibition include the Arts Council of Northern Ireland, and the Department of Culture, Arts and Leisure.
